Been quite busy over the last few weeks. Decided to move on the Tri-logo and POTF MOCs that I've owned for around 20 years in favour of some earlier MOCs. I had Romba, Warok, Paploo, Lumat, Imp Gunner, Lando General, Imp Dignitary, Rancor Keeper and Prune Face. All very nice- some superb, however, I don't really remember them from when I was a kid, and that's what most of this is about for me. I want to own MOCs that I used to see hanging in the local toy shops, newsagents and department stores. This means mainly ESB, with a few SW and ROTJ thrown in for good measure.

My plan was to p/x the MOCs for the equivalent loose figure + cash where possible. It worked out surprisingly well and I managed to get hold of all but 3 in this way. The extra cash went towards new MOCs- I have been after a minty Leia Bespin for ages now, so pleased to find one! I also managed to pick up some mini-rigs, and loose figures that I didn't have, such as Ree Yees (as I already had the equivalent MOC). I love the price stickers on two of the mini-rigs: Co-Op and Boots 8)

I'm still waiting on one more ESB MOC and 3 more loose figures. The loosies will complete my loose run (apart from a VCJ- I'm still working on that one!).
